Essential Job Duties and Responsibilities:
- GENERAL SECURITY
- Lock up and unlock all buildings of the Christian Mission as needed or requested
- Monitor camera system for any unusual occurrence or deviant behavior on property
- Help diffuse conflictive situations for employees when walk up clients or others on Mission property are rude, disrespectful, violent, or troublesome
- Assist in getting new keys made for campus buildings as needed
- Keep accurate and up to date emergency phone numbers, drug testing files, client Family Visit sign outs, and doctor’s appointments
- Lock up maintenance equipment storage shed nightly
- Assist in moving trucks and trailers as needed
- Assist with any food dropoff donations after hours, store away in coolers, and give donor a tax deductible receipt
- In the event of an emergency immediately, the position notifies the appropriate personal (Police,
Fire Department, etc.) then calls the Executive Director (Assistant Director if Executive is not available)
- Ensures that no one trespasses on Christian Mission property. Identify such persons and ask them to leave. Do not try to remove them from the property. Call the police for help.
- In the event of an incident, fill out in detail the incident report form. Make copies and give to
Executive Director and Assistant Executive Director as soon as possible.
- NEW LIFE CLIENT ASSISTANCE
- Pass out medication to New Life clients according to their approved list by the director
- Transport male students on Sunday mornings to a local church for worship
- Drug Test male clients, as needed, in the case of abnormal behavior or at the specific request of the Executive or Assistant Director or probation officer; female client testing done by Mission office staff
- Drug Test clients staying in the emergency Women’s and Children shelter prior to lodging them and assist with getting their luggage to the storage bins on campus;
- Sign out clients for family visits and doctor’s appointments
- Assist clients with phone calls made to family members and doctor’s office ensuring confirmed person on the other end of the phone prior to the conversation beginning with New Life client
